Average Healthcare Support Workers, All Other Salary in Winchester, VA-WV
The average salary for a Healthcare Support Workers, All Other in Winchester, VA-WV is $47,440.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market.
Executive Summary
- Average Salary: $47,440 per year.
-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 17.3% ↗ over the last 5 years.
-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$64,270.
- Outlook: The current demand for Healthcare Support Workers, All Others is stable, with a local workforce of approximately 50 professionals. This role remains a specialized component of the broader Winchester, VA-WV economy.

Healthcare Support Workers, All Other Salary Distribution in Winchester, VA-WV
The earning potential for Healthcare Support Workers, All Others in Winchester, VA-WV varies significantly by experience level. The salary gap is relatively narrow, suggesting consistent and predictable earnings from entry-level to senior positions.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$37,730,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$64,270.

How much does a Healthcare Support Workers, All Other make in Winchester, VA-WV?
The median annual salary for a Healthcare Support Workers, All Other in Winchester, VA-WV is $47,440. This typically ranges from $37,730 for entry-level positions to $64,270 for top-level roles.
How does the salary compare to the national average?
The average salary for this role in Winchester, VA-WV is 1.6% higher than the national median of $46,710.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 50 employees in the Winchester, VA-WV area with a job density of 0.798 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
